Spent an afternoon in its outdoor seating and stayed for a dinner.
It can get busy on weekend nights, so I recommend to make a booking. Also, there are lots of bench seating outdoors, but was quite windy and chilly despite the sunny weather early March.
They only serve local beers on tap. So there was a limited option, on that day was 1 lager, 2 pale ale (1 non-alcoholic) and a cider. Spirits and wine have more options though.
Indoor seating is a bit cozy (exact word the hostess used, I thought was cozy-warm but meant cozy-tight and small). Toilets were not wheelchair friendly but the restaurant was pet-friendly. The end where we sat for dinner was cold, without a working heater. We had to wear our coats.
My husband enjoyed the rib eye steak, nice and tender. The foccacia starter had a generous portion of the bread and olive oil. The duck leg was good as well but the portion was a bit small (£24 for a drumstick). I would be willing to pay a little more for a proper leg portion.
The view outside the pub is gorgeous. Parking lot can accomodate a lot of cars.

Nestled in the scenic Surrey Hills, Botley Hill Farmhouse offers a perfect escape from London’s bustle, combining stunning countryside views with hearty, well-prepared food.

The first thing that stands out is the breathtaking location. Perched at one of the highest points in the North Downs, the farmhouse provides panoramic views of rolling fields and woodlands, making it an excellent spot for a relaxed meal, especially at sunset. Whether you’re dining inside the rustic yet elegant restaurant or outside on the terrace, the setting enhances the experience.

The menu is a mix of classic British dishes with a modern touch. The Sunday roasts are a highlight, particularly the slow-roasted beef, which is tender and full of flavor, served with crispy roast potatoes, rich gravy, and perfectly cooked vegetables. The fish and chips are another standout, with a light, crispy batter and flaky fish. Vegetarian options, like the wild mushroom risotto, are equally satisfying. The desserts, particularly the sticky toffee pudding, are indulgent and well worth saving room for.

Service is warm and efficient, adding to the welcoming atmosphere. Prices are reasonable for the quality and setting, making it a great choice for a special meal or a weekend outing.

If you’re looking for a peaceful countryside retreat with excellent food and spectacular views, Botley Hill Farmhouse is well worth a visit.
